The Importance of Slot Design

Slots are more than a game of chance - they're also an expression of art and design. Slot machines are designed with immersive themes and aesthetics that help capture the attention of players and increase their gaming experience.

To create an online slot machine that is a hit with the public it is crucial to conduct thorough research on the player demographics and their preferences. This includes things like paylines, payout percents, and volatility.

Symbols

Symbols are the key to slot games, and they can aid players in achieving the highest winnings. They can come in a variety of forms, but they all have the same function in order to make winning combinations and provide an idea of what's possible. They're also a vital component of the game's theme and design. There are numerous symbols to keep an eye out for regardless of whether you're playing an ancient Egyptian themed game or video slots with a pirate theme.

Slot symbols have evolved over the years and each have a distinct function. The 777 symbol is an example. It is an icon of luck and good fortune that is widely accepted. However, the history of slot symbols dates far back than that. Charles Fey's first machines featured horseshoes and card suits as symbols, as well as a Liberty Bell. As gambling laws changed and cash prizes were made illegal Fey's machines started dispensing chewing gum instead. This unique solution was a huge success and has become a long-lasting tradition on slot machines.

Modern slot machines come with a variety of types of symbols, including wilds and scatters. Scatters appear everywhere on the reels and bring about bonus rounds. They can also increase the value of your winnings by increasing the amount. Some modern slot games also offer expanding, stacked, or sticky wilds that can increase your chances of landing a winning combination. While these features are purely optional, they can enhance your gaming experience. But, it's crucial to understand how they work prior to playing the slot machine. This will allow you to develop more efficient strategies and increase your chances of winning.

Bonus rounds

Bonus rounds are an integral part of slot design that enhance the gameplay and increase the excitement of spinning reels. They could be mini-games or play-to-win games. They can also be interactive and make the player feel as though they are in a world of entertainment. Bonus rounds also present new opportunities for players to win huge prizes and increase their chances of a jackpot payout. Bonus rounds can be initiated by scatters, special symbols, or unique combinations of other game elements, and they are often associated with multipliers, which can make them even more lucrative.

No matter if they're free-spins, multipliers, or interactive games bonus rounds are among of the most sought-after features of slot machines. These features increase the excitement and make a spin feel like an adventure. They're also an excellent way to keep players interested and motivated to place more bets.

Although these elements might not be crucial to the gaming experience of a slot machine they do create a sense of anticipation and increase the possibility for big payouts. Many players are attracted to the idea of winning a jackpot which could be as high as millions of dollars. However the odds of winning are much lower than the actual prize. Therefore, players must know the odds of winning before they decide to play.

There are a variety of bonus rounds in slot machines, including Multipliers, Item Selection, and Free Spins. Free spins are a popular choice among players because they can result in massive payouts. These rounds can be retriggered for even more bonuses. These features can be particularly thrilling for those who love the thrill of attempting to beat the odds.

Themes

Themes are a crucial aspect of slot design because they influence the player's perceptions of luck as well as fortune. This influences their level of satisfaction as well as enjoyment of the games. Themes can help players differentiate games and make them more exciting and exciting. Additionally, a well-designed theme can encourage players to play longer and more often.

The options for slot themes are endless. They can be based on anything from popular culture to ancient history. Some slot machines are themed after famous TV shows or movies, while others are themed after specific sports or musicians. These themes help to attract niche audiences and boost the popularity of a game.

Some of the most popular themes for slot machines are based on mythology, fairytales and fantasy worlds. These themes appeal to a player's sense of adventure and can generate a sense of excitement. They also impart important life lessons to players through their narratives or aesthetics. Some of the most popular themes are themed around entertainment, music, and holidays. These themes aid in connecting players to their favorite brands and entertain them throughout the game.

The themes in slot games can change significantly based on the preferences of the audience. A slot game based on the most popular movie or musician will do well in areas that are highly regarded for the film or band. A sports-themed slot will, on the other hand be a failure in nations that aren't very well-known for the sport.

Slot themes will change as tastes in media change. Slot themes will adapt to changes in pop culture, be it the emergence of an emerging trend or the emergence of a revival. It's hard to predict what will become an increasingly popular theme in the future since tastes change quickly.
